Amazon Location Service enhances Places APIs with new address and search options
News
Amazon Location Service announced enhancements to its Places APIs, giving developers greater control over address formatting, multilingual support, and location search capabilities.
- AddressNamesMode parameter controls address component name formatting (matched, normalized, or administrative)
- AddressTranslations parameter returns place names in 50+ languages for multilingual applications
- TravelMode parameter optimizes search results for navigation and in-vehicle scenarios
- DriveThrough attribute indicates whether places offer drive-through service
- Parsing.AdditionalInfo field provides details on address interpretation
- Available across 14 AWS regions globally
These enhancements enable developers to build more flexible, multilingual, and context-aware location-based applications.
